CGDevTools Forum

Welcome to the Official CGDevTools Support Community Forums.

Nw component for to create Vector Graphics with mouse/keyboard/Touch events or Sketchpad

Suggest new components/features

by fduenas » 22 Jan 2013 04:52

Hi it shoudl be greaet if you can include something to create a sketchpad for makeing basic drawings over ana already TIWImage or any other region.

Something seen in demos from JQuery SVG (http://keith-wood.name/svg.html) Sketpacth demo,
Paperjs (http://paperjs.org/tutorials/interaction/creating-mouse-tools/#click-drag-release) or
raphaeljs (http://raphaeljs.com/)

There is beta version demo in uniGUI (http://www.unigui.com/demo) 'Canvas' that approaches something http://prime.fmsoft.net/demo/canvas.dll

Also check: http://kineticjs.com/

Maybe not such fancy as them, but being able to have a basic canvas with predefined shapes to create drawings with their specific property like With, color, brush and pen. maybe also this canvas can be drawe over an existing TIWImage or other TIWControl.

Regards
fduenas
 
Posts: 124
Joined: 29 May 2012 12:54

by Jorge Sousa » 22 Jan 2013 13:31

Hi fduenas

All these plugins seems interesting yes.

We definitelly want to add something like a sketpatch

Best Regards

cgdevtools
Best Regards
CGDevTools Develop / Support Team
Home Page: http://www.cgdevtools.com
Jorge Sousa
 
Posts: 4261
Joined: 17 May 2012 09:58

by fduenas » 24 Jan 2013 05:06

Exactly, for now paper.JS looks very promissing as a Swiss Knife for vector graphics, I like the way they manage the Path's for drawing dinamycally Lines, rectangles circles etc with mouse events. Dont know iif this can be done wiht SVG, SVG is more compatible with old browsers because it doesn't relies on HTML 5 (canvas) to work. and also Jquery SVG is a plugin of JQuery :), wich is the bas of your product. And maybe return to Intaweb server an array of points in JSON, XML or custom format, so the images can be processed internally.
fduenas
 
Posts: 124
Joined: 29 May 2012 12:54


Return to Suggestions

Who is online

Users browsing this forum: No registered users and 4 guests

Contact Us.